Transaction 8da59f951700a229031807c3489a3f8816337d46e104a566f42cacfa9511b01c

1 Input
2 Outputs
  • 8da59f951700a229031807c3489a3f8816337d46e104a566f42cacfa9511b01c:0
  • value  3316100
    address  1DVSjXgszyRrSo2NCCcRSXFCghkx65ZCmf
  • 8da59f951700a229031807c3489a3f8816337d46e104a566f42cacfa9511b01c:1
  • value  175265891
    address  1CCNvW8WEdjorEbFK2SxWxy7yLpkXZbQJ1